Fire alarm triggered by candle smoke at college dorm, Wellesley MA


A fire alarm was activated at a college dormitory on Map Hill Drive, Babson Park. Firefighters found smoke caused by candles, not an actual fire. The fire department investigated, reset the system, and ended the response.
